sqlserver存储过程的基本操作:
一、创建存储过程
1、语法格式:
create proc | procedure pro_name
[{@参数数据类型} [=默认值] [output],
{@参数数据类型} [=默认值] [output],
....
]
as
SQL_statements
以上是最基本语法,举个简单的例子:
CREATE proc p_test
as
select retu = 1
存储过程返回一个结果集:1
2、执行存储过程
EXECUTE Procedure_name '' --存储过程如果有参数,后面加参数格式为:@参数名=value,也可直接为参数值value
例子调用结果:
3、删除存储过程
drop procedure procedure_name --在存储过程中能调用另外一个存储过程,而不能删除另外一个存储过程